About the Role
As a Senior Project Manager, you will lead complex civil engineering and land development projects from concept through completion. In this pivotal role, you will serve as the primary client representative—ensuring strong communication, technical excellence, and project delivery within scope, schedule, and budget.
You will provide oversight across all aspects of project design, permitting, and execution while mentoring project teams and contributing to the ongoing growth and success of the firm.

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ering.
- Professional Engineer (PE) license in Colorado or ability to obtain within 6 months.
- 10+ years of progressive civil engineering experience, including project management and land development design for a variety of project types (private, municipal, recreational, educational).
- Proven track record managing multiple complex projects and client relationships.
